Output e69942deda07fc97c2af8420ae4a5cfa9264baa5c60384bfc198b953537b1279: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b02cb6d8ec3e0ef73b0a8afa458df5665d7d09a OP_EQUALVERIFY OP_CHECKSIG
address
14vRQRaSAgpzT6qbm2THhgL9joxEVCaCNM
transaction
e69942deda07fc97c2af8420ae4a5cfa9264baa5c60384bfc198b953537b1279
confirmations
502935
spent
true